Use Divine Confetti. It greatly increases your damage to hp and posture to them and lets you pop their orbs with a sword swing. Chug a relaxing potion and Ako Sugar (attack increase) along with confetti then BUMRUSH HIS ASS. With Confetti you'll do enough stagger and posture damage to stop his casting. After a few hits he'll back off and turn invisible, do not follow him or he'll backstab and kill you. Back off instead and wait for him to re-appear in a a different location. Once he does, he will gather energy and do a laser beam attack thing. With Confetti active, you can deflect/parry it and take no damage. Do so then RUSH HIM again. This time his posture will break and you can execute him. Repeat one more time for his second health bar.
If you're fast enough you might be able to get away with using only one Divine Confetti, but I found I needed two. Also if your terror bar ever gets near finishing chug a Relaxing potion immediately - it instant kills you.
